Newcastle United reach agreement to sell Yankuba Minteh to Premier League rival – Report

Image de l'article :Newcastle United reach agreement to sell Yankuba Minteh to Premier League rival – Report

Newcastle United have agreed to sell Yankuba Minteh to Brighton.

An exclusive from the ever reliable David Ornstein of The Athletic breaking the news.

The man from The Athletic saying that the fee is in the region of £33m.

David Ornstein states that the 19-year-old has been given permission to discuss personal terms with Brighton.

He says those talks will take place this Saturday evening but that they are not expected to be a major issue.

All kinds of claims/speculation have surrounded countless Newcastle United players, whether they would potentially be sold in order to get NUFC on the right side of PSR (Profit and Sustainability Rules).

The deadline for this year’s accounts is Sunday 30 June and then £105m losses allowed from 1 July 2021 to 30 June 2024.

Amongst the players claimed who could be sold, have been Bruno, Alexander Isak, Elliot Anderson and Anthony Gordon.

Ironic then that we are now back with the player, Yankuba Minteh, who was the first to be the subject of much speculation earlier this month, in terms of a potential NUFC sale to satisfy PSR.

Assuming this Minteh transfer goes ahead without any issues, we await with interest (fear!) to see whether that £33m deal (Yankuba Minteh cost around £6.5m 12 months ago) will be enough on its own to meet PSR targets this month/season/three year period.
